You will play a key role in developing and maintaining our next generation data platform in a fast-paced, agile environment. Partnering closely with the Product, Operations and Engineering teams, you will be responsible for delivering data-driven solutions to complex business problems as well as serve as a trusted advisor to the technical teams.
Engineer solutions to aggregate and automate large-scale data flows from varying sources
Work as a part of a cross-functional team (Product, Data Science and Data Integration ) to build and maintain scalable data solutions
Collaborate with product owners in an agile environment to analyze requirements and translate them into functioning software
Lead/own the tactical implementation of new product/analytics once scope/strategy is defined
Primary escalation contact for bugs, onboarding issues, ad hoc functionality needs
Implement key tech debt and enhancements and process improvements to improve overall efficiency of the data team
Manage escalations and problem solving solutions regarding critical issues that require immediate attention and remediation
Responsible for the monitoring and maintenance of the health of servers and databases for all inbound data and ongoing warehousing
This role should be able to serve as internal education and support for Integration Engineers
Provide mentoring to and collaboration with other team members and technical leadership to more junior team members
Bachelor's degree in Computer Science, Engineering or related quantitative fields
Proven experience as a Data Engineer or in a related role such as Database Administrator, Data Warehouse Developer or Big Data Engineer which all require a strong record of working with large data sets
Real world expertise in data modeling and structure of databases, ETL development and data warehousing plus a demonstrated mastery with one or more data warehouse and processing technologies such as AWS Redshift, Oracle, PostgreSQL, Hadoop, Spark
Hands on experience with cloud computing and Linux-based systems
A mastery of using SQL with large data sets and a deep understanding of query performance tuning
Must be able to mentor others in the use of SQL with large data sets
Proven track record of successful communication of data infrastructure, data models and data engineering solutions through written communication including the ability to effectively communicate with both business and technical teams
Show curiosity and an ability to learn quickly, especially regarding new technology and processes
Approach all work with a team-based/collaborative orientation
The company is an equal opportunity employer and will consider all applications without regards to race, sex, age, color, religion, national origin, veteran status, disability, sexual orientation, gender identity, genetic information or any characteristic protected by law.
OpenArc is a technology consulting firm providing industry-leading technical talent placement, software development, and technology strategy services to clients nationwide. Through a unique blending of people and software, OpenArc has a business practice that delivers amazing enterprise, mobile and consumer-facing apps and the best talent for contract, contract-to-hire and direct placements for clients and partners alike.
Staffed with the most-trusted recruiting experts, elite software developers, UI/UX designers and market experts, our team provides clients with the best resources, the right techniques and world-class support resulting in powerful measurable success.